Boiled the beads, got a lot of oil residue out from the Ganesh bead

that came free with my order. I boiled my other beads but they needed

less time in the water.

 

The contrast effect is now gone... It originally look was a like

silver jewellery with dark etchings but I suspect it be back again soon.

 

Best way to go about it was to tied up each individually to a

chopstick with just enough length so that it does not touch the pot

and then leave it for an hour.

 

Those strands/fibres are the pulp. I don't think it possible to 100

percent remove all. I used a small pin to scrape out what I could.

Initially, boiling them was gave some heartache. They darkened a lot,

some part looked black. But once cooled, the blackness left.

 

The "broth" smelled rather nice though. No I didn't drink it...
